All 4 of them are interesting and very different. Rabb and Skal are pretty far from contributing in the NBA, but hey, I thought the same thing about Gobert when I saw his videos before the draft. Sometimes these college coaches don't bring out the best in a player. Sabonis is really interesting in the late lottery. He uses both hands effectively and is already very good at keeping the ball high and going right to the basket. Something Len still hasn't learned to do consistently. Ellenson is hard to figure out. He lost a lot of weight and is kind of a face up post player. He does bang inside but does not play above the rim. Very fundamentally sound. I think he would be the safest of the 4 but least likely to be a home run.
